This technical article examines the energy efficiency of pumping systems specifically within the pulp and paper industry. It outlines the significant role that pumping systems play in industrial energy consumption, accounting for over 20% of the world's electrical energy demand. The article emphasizes the importance of optimizing pumping systems to achieve substantial energy and cost savings while also reducing carbon emissions. It discusses various factors influencing energy efficiency, including pump design, operation, and maintenance. The article further highlights the life cycle costs associated with pumping systems, noting that initial purchase prices often represent a small fraction of total costs. It details strategies for improving efficiency, such as selecting the right pump technology, utilizing variable speed drives, and optimizing system layout to minimize energy losses. The article concludes by emphasizing the need for continuous monitoring and maintenance to ensure pumps operate at peak efficiency, thereby maximizing productivity and minimizing operational costs.
